You have to look in the Registry for them. Start>Run type: regedit
Navigate to
Hkey_Local_Machine\Software\Microsoft\Windows\Current Version\Run, Run
once, etc. In the rt pane
you will see those entries. You can delete them. Also, check in
Hkey_Current_User\Software\Microsoft\Windows\Current Version\Run
If there delete them.
